summaryrefslogtreecommitdiffstats
path: root/sdnr/wt/odlux/framework/src/components/titleBar.tsx
diff options
context:
space:
mode:
authorHerbert Eiselt <herbert.eiselt@highstreet-technologies.com>2019-06-07 17:40:50 +0200
committerHerbert Eiselt <herbert.eiselt@highstreet-technologies.com>2019-06-07 17:41:24 +0200
commitd93e6a996e60fb6abce9a870cef6b2d57bfa70fd (patch)
tree97595acb7fa809e742beb6cd5eeaaeab5f956ba9 /sdnr/wt/odlux/framework/src/components/titleBar.tsx
parent1445dabe9bc28629077033e2f189ad05dc61b884 (diff)
SDNR Add missing status bar to ODLUX Framework
Modify framework and adapt all apps Issue-ID: SDNC-789 Signed-off-by: Herbert Eiselt <herbert.eiselt@highstreet-technologies.com> Change-Id: I1ea0a3df6c3f6db08f2bd7a21eb3b4cbf230a08a Signed-off-by: Herbert Eiselt <herbert.eiselt@highstreet-technologies.com>
Diffstat (limited to 'sdnr/wt/odlux/framework/src/components/titleBar.tsx')
-rw-r--r--sdnr/wt/odlux/framework/src/components/titleBar.tsx8
1 files changed, 7 insertions, 1 deletions
diff --git a/sdnr/wt/odlux/framework/src/components/titleBar.tsx b/sdnr/wt/odlux/framework/src/components/titleBar.tsx
index a3ba571ec..230dda400 100644
--- a/sdnr/wt/odlux/framework/src/components/titleBar.tsx
+++ b/sdnr/wt/odlux/framework/src/components/titleBar.tsx
@@ -69,12 +69,18 @@ class TitleBarComponent extends React.Component<TitleBarProps, { anchorEl: HTMLE
<MenuIcon />
</IconButton>
<Logo />
- <Typography variant="title" color="inherit" className={ classes.grow }>
+ <Typography variant="title" color="inherit" >
{ state.framework.applicationState.icon
? (<FontAwesomeIcon className={ classes.icon } icon={ state.framework.applicationState.icon } />)
: null }
{ state.framework.applicationState.title }
</Typography>
+ <div className={classes.grow}></div>
+ { state.framework.applicationRegistraion && Object.keys(state.framework.applicationRegistraion).map(key => {
+ const reg = state.framework.applicationRegistraion[key];
+ return reg && reg.statusBarElement && <reg.statusBarElement key={key} /> || null
+ })}
+
{ state.framework.authenticationState.user
? (<div>
<Button